China's Innovation Revolution
This chapter examines China's distinctive role in innovation, shaped by its adaptive population and unique regulatory environment. It contrasts the rapid adoption of mobile payment technologies in China with the slower uptake in the U.S., highlighting the influence of government infrastructure and societal behaviors. The discussion also focuses on the success of companies like Pinduoduo, which have transformed e-commerce and made products more accessible to a large demographic.
